They call me a princess. An heir to a city built on the blood and bones of innocent lives.

I have no desire to rule—not if it means becoming like the family who threw me away like garbage. But there is one thing I want more than my freedom.

To save the only man in this city who thinks I’m worth keeping.

What I feel for Grey is as forbidden as it is real.

As much as I want to run away and never look back, I could never abandon him. But if I want to keep us both from being eaten alive, I’ll have to convince them all he’s nothing to me.

Worse, I’ll have to betray him to his enemies.

The only thing that can help us now is a mate bond I’m not sure exists for someone like me. There’s only one way to find out and it means risking my life in hopes of becoming the wolf I was meant to be.

This will either break the spell and make me strong enough for what’s coming—or it will be a deadly wolf bite. Either way, I can’t stand by and watch the man I love go down without a fight.
